Multicast routing enabled in core network
I have enabled multicast routing in the core switch to allow multicast streams to be routed to the ops network from the auxilliary network (between VLAN 20 and 106) - this is to support the upcoming digital video system.  The Loopback0 interface has been created in the switch to act as the PIM RP[1] for the CDS network, with address 172.17.2.1/32.  Interfaces Vlan20 and Vlan106 are configured to use 'ip pim sparse-dense-mode'.  No other VLANS are currently configured to route multicast traffic.

[1] Protocol Independent Multicast Rendezvous Point
